A German silver-mounted willow stick, late 19th century
the silver handle moulded with two foliate panels with a vacant cartouche, the stick with willow tendril, with later shaft, 151,5cm; and a German silver-mounted stinkwood walking stick, late 19th century, of crook form, with brass ferrule, dents, with later shaft, 103,5cm
